Overview

The ADG507AKRUZ is a CMOS monolithic analog multiplexer produced by Analog Devices Inc. This device is part of the ADG507A series, which features dual 8-channel analog multiplexers. The ADG507A switches one of eight differential inputs to a common differential output, controlled by three binary addresses and an enable input. It is designed on an enhanced LC2MOS process, enabling operation over a wide range of supply voltages from 10.8 V to 16.5 V, either in single or dual supply configurations. The device is known for its high switching speeds, low RON, and compatibility with TTL and 5 V CMOS logic digital inputs.

Key Specifications

Parameter Value Unit
Number of Channels 8 (differential)
Supply Voltage Range 10.8 V to 16.5 V (single or dual) V
On Resistance (RON) 300 Ω (max) Ω
Switching Time (tON, tOFF) 250 ns (typ), 450 ns (max) ns
Charge Injection 4 pC (typ) pC
Off Isolation 68 dB (typ) dB
Digital Input Capacitance 8 pF (max) pF
Package Type 28-Lead TSSOP
Operating Temperature Range -40°C to 85°C °C
